Updating minimum wage setting in the Republic of Moldova

The ILO will upgrade the existing mechanism of the minimum wage setting in order to build resilient mechanisms to enhance population living standards in the country.

The ILO will provide technical assistance to support Moldova in merging the current two minimum wages into one and in defining a mechanism to set it and update it regularly. To do so, the ILO will support the National Commission for Consultations and Collective Bargaining by producing empirical evidence about the wage distribution and its characteristics.  The ILO will also gather international good practices so that the new mechanism is based on the most updated information and international standards.

In addition, assistance will be provided in building the capacity of social partners so that they can more effectively adjust wages through collective bargaining. The Collective Agreement in Construction will be reviewed and used as a benchmark for other sectoral level wage agreements.
